Move x86_64 timer_*.c out of nptl/

This commit is contained in:
Roland McGrath 2014-05-14 10:35:39 -07:00
parent 941d7dfd24
commit 3a51fb6047
18 changed files with 56 additions and 22 deletions

View File

@ -1,5 +1,38 @@
2014-05-14 Roland McGrath <roland@hack.frob.com>
* nptl/sysdeps/unix/sysv/linux/x86_64/Versions: Remove, merge into ...
* sysdeps/unix/sysv/linux/x86_64/Versions: ... here.
* nptl/sysdeps/unix/sysv/linux/x86_64/timer_create.c: Moved ...
* sysdeps/unix/sysv/linux/x86_64/timer_create.c: here.
* nptl/sysdeps/unix/sysv/linux/x86_64/timer_delete.c: Moved ...
* sysdeps/unix/sysv/linux/x86_64/timer_delete.c: ... here
* nptl/sysdeps/unix/sysv/linux/x86_64/timer_getoverr.c: Moved ...
* sysdeps/unix/sysv/linux/x86_64/timer_getoverr.c: ... here
* nptl/sysdeps/unix/sysv/linux/x86_64/timer_gettime.c: Moved ...
* sysdeps/unix/sysv/linux/x86_64/timer_gettime.c: ... here
* nptl/sysdeps/unix/sysv/linux/x86_64/timer_settime.c: Moved ...
* sysdeps/unix/sysv/linux/x86_64/timer_settime.c: ... here
* nptl/sysdeps/unix/sysv/linux/powerpc/powerpc64/timer_create.c:
Update #include.
* nptl/sysdeps/unix/sysv/linux/powerpc/powerpc64/timer_delete.c:
Likewise.
* nptl/sysdeps/unix/sysv/linux/powerpc/powerpc64/timer_getoverr.c:
Likewise.
* nptl/sysdeps/unix/sysv/linux/powerpc/powerpc64/timer_gettime.c:
Likewise.
* nptl/sysdeps/unix/sysv/linux/powerpc/powerpc64/timer_settime.c:
Likewise.
* nptl/sysdeps/unix/sysv/linux/sparc/sparc64/timer_create.c:
Likewise.
* nptl/sysdeps/unix/sysv/linux/sparc/sparc64/timer_delete.c:
Likewise.
* nptl/sysdeps/unix/sysv/linux/sparc/sparc64/timer_getoverr.c:
Likewise.
* nptl/sysdeps/unix/sysv/linux/sparc/sparc64/timer_gettime.c:
Likewise.
* nptl/sysdeps/unix/sysv/linux/sparc/sparc64/timer_settime.c:
Likewise.
* sysdeps/unix/sysv/linux/x86_64/clone.S: Deconditionalize the code
that was previously under [RESET_PID].
* sysdeps/unix/sysv/linux/i386/clone.S: Likewise.

View File

@ -1 +1 @@
#include "../x86_64/timer_create.c"
#include <sysdeps/unix/sysv/linux/x86_64/timer_create.c>

View File

@ -1 +1 @@
#include "../x86_64/timer_delete.c"
#include <sysdeps/unix/sysv/linux/x86_64/timer_delete.c>

View File

@ -1 +1 @@
#include "../x86_64/timer_getoverr.c"
#include <sysdeps/unix/sysv/linux/x86_64/timer_getoverr.c>

View File

@ -1 +1 @@
#include "../x86_64/timer_gettime.c"
#include <sysdeps/unix/sysv/linux/x86_64/timer_gettime.c>

View File

@ -1 +1 @@
#include "../x86_64/timer_settime.c"
#include <sysdeps/unix/sysv/linux/x86_64/timer_settime.c>

View File

@ -1 +1 @@
#include "../../x86_64/timer_create.c"
#include <sysdeps/unix/sysv/linux/x86_64/timer_create.c>

View File

@ -1 +1 @@
#include "../../x86_64/timer_delete.c"
#include <sysdeps/unix/sysv/linux/x86_64/timer_delete.c>

View File

@ -1 +1 @@
#include "../../x86_64/timer_getoverr.c"
#include <sysdeps/unix/sysv/linux/x86_64/timer_getoverr.c>

View File

@ -1 +1 @@
#include "../../x86_64/timer_gettime.c"
#include <sysdeps/unix/sysv/linux/x86_64/timer_gettime.c>

View File

@ -1 +1 @@
#include "../../x86_64/timer_settime.c"
#include <sysdeps/unix/sysv/linux/x86_64/timer_settime.c>

View File

@ -1,7 +0,0 @@
librt {
GLIBC_2.3.3 {
# Changed timer_t.
timer_create; timer_delete; timer_getoverrun; timer_gettime;
timer_settime;
}
}

View File

@ -10,3 +10,11 @@ libc {
__vdso_clock_gettime;
}
}
librt {
GLIBC_2.3.3 {
# Changed timer_t.
timer_create; timer_delete; timer_getoverrun; timer_gettime;
timer_settime;
}
}

View File

@ -22,7 +22,7 @@
#define timer_create_alias __timer_create_new
#include "../timer_create.c"
#include <sysdeps/unix/sysv/linux/timer_create.c>
#undef timer_create
versioned_symbol (librt, __timer_create_new, timer_create, GLIBC_2_3_3);

View File

@ -21,7 +21,7 @@
#define timer_delete_alias __timer_delete_new
#include "../timer_delete.c"
#include <sysdeps/unix/sysv/linux/timer_delete.c>
#undef timer_delete
versioned_symbol (librt, __timer_delete_new, timer_delete, GLIBC_2_3_3);

View File

@ -21,7 +21,7 @@
#define timer_getoverrun_alias __timer_getoverrun_new
#include "../timer_getoverr.c"
#include <sysdeps/unix/sysv/linux/timer_getoverr.c>
#undef timer_getoverrun
versioned_symbol (librt, __timer_getoverrun_new, timer_getoverrun,

View File

@ -21,7 +21,7 @@
#define timer_gettime_alias __timer_gettime_new
#include "../timer_gettime.c"
#include <sysdeps/unix/sysv/linux/timer_gettime.c>
#undef timer_gettime
versioned_symbol (librt, __timer_gettime_new, timer_gettime, GLIBC_2_3_3);

View File

@ -21,7 +21,7 @@
#define timer_settime_alias __timer_settime_new
#include "../timer_settime.c"
#include <sysdeps/unix/sysv/linux/timer_settime.c>
#undef timer_settime
versioned_symbol (librt, __timer_settime_new, timer_settime, GLIBC_2_3_3);